Summary
scEpiSearch is a new tool for analyzing single-cell epigenome data. It accurately searches and classifies cell profiles, revealing cellular heterogeneity and regulatory states in various cell types.
Area of Science:
- Genomics
- Computational Biology
- Cell Biology
Background:
- Large-scale single-cell data analysis requires advanced tools for cell annotation.
- Matching single-cell epigenome profiles to reference datasets is a significant computational challenge.
Purpose of the Study:
- To develop and validate scEpiSearch, a novel computational tool for searching, comparing, and classifying single-cell open-chromatin profiles.
- To demonstrate scEpiSearch's utility in identifying cellular heterogeneity and regulatory states across diverse biological contexts.
Main Methods:
- Development of scEpiSearch for querying single-cell open-chromatin data against large reference datasets.
- Benchmarking scEpiSearch's performance against existing methods for accuracy and coembedding.
- Application of scEpiSearch to analyze epigenome profiles from K562 cells, acute leukemia patient samples, and embryonic stem cells (ESCs).
Main Results:
- scEpiSearch demonstrated superior accuracy in searching and coembedding single-cell profiles compared to other methods.
- The tool successfully identified heterogeneity, multipotency, and dedifferentiation in K562 cells and leukemia samples.
- scEpiSearch revealed specific ESC subpopulations poised for endoplasmic reticulum stress and unfolded protein response.
Conclusions:
- scEpiSearch effectively addresses the challenge of integrating large single-cell epigenome datasets.
- The tool enables the identification and study of cell-specific regulatory states using epigenomic information.
- scEpiSearch provides a powerful platform for exploring cellular heterogeneity and function at single-cell resolution.
